Understanding Workers Compensation

Workers’ compensation is a state-mandated insurance program that provides benefits to employees who suffer job-related injuries or workplace injuries or illnesses. While it sounds straightforward, the reality is often complicated by legal nuances, paperwork, and insurance company tactics aimed at minimizing payouts.

The Role of a Workers Comp Lawyer

So, what do workers’ comp lawyers do exactly? Here’s how we assist you:

1. Filing Accurate and Timely Claims

One of the most critical steps in the workers’ compensation process is filing your claim correctly and on time. Mistakes or delays can result in denied benefits. Our lawyers ensure all paperwork is completed accurately, helping you avoid common pitfalls.

2. Gathering Essential Evidence

Proving the extent of your injuries, the need for medical treatment, and their connection to your job is crucial. We help collect medical records, expert testimonies, and other vital evidence to build a strong case on your behalf.

3. Negotiating with Insurance Companies

Insurance companies, guided by their employer’s interests, often aim to minimize the compensation they pay out, making settlement negotiations a crucial part of securing the benefits you deserve, including covering your medical bills. Our experienced attorneys negotiate aggressively to secure the maximum benefits for you, including medical expenses, lost wages, and rehabilitation costs.

4. Representing You in Hearings and Appeals

If your claim is denied or disputed, you may need to attend hearings or file appeals, or even face a trial. We represent you throughout these litigation proceedings, presenting compelling arguments to support your case.

What should I bring to my consultation with a workers comp lawyer?

Bring any relevant documents, such as medical records, medical bills, information about your medical treatment, employment information, employer details, and any correspondence related to your injury or claim.
